The algorithm gives a preference to applicants from the most prestigious colleges and universities, because those applicants have done best in the past. Therefore, the data-mining process and the categories used by predictive algorithms can convey biases and lead to discriminatory results which affect socially salient groups even if the algorithm itself, as a mathematical construct, is a priori neutral and only looks for correlations associated with a given outcome. Theoretically, it could help to ensure that a decision is informed by clearly defined and justifiable variables and objectives; it potentially allows the programmers to identify the trade-offs between the rights of all and the goals pursued; and it could even enable them to identify and mitigate the influence of human biases. Bechavod and Ligett (2017) address the disparate mistreatment notion of fairness by formulating the machine learning problem as a optimization over not only accuracy but also minimizing differences between false positive/negative rates across groups. A paradigmatic example of direct discrimination would be to refuse employment to a person on the basis of race, national or ethnic origin, colour, religion, sex, age or mental or physical disability, among other possible grounds. Adverse impact occurs when an employment practice appears neutral on the surface but nevertheless leads to unjustified adverse impact on members of a protected class. They are used to decide who should be promoted or fired, who should get a loan or an insurance premium (and at what cost), what publications appear on your social media feed [47, 49] or even to map crime hot spots and to try and predict the risk of recidivism of past offenders [66].
